setting VLAN=xx to different values for each interfaces solves this
problem. By default interfaces seem to be put into the same VLAN and
that creates a loop with the bridge. The default should put each
interface in a different VLAN. I can't even think of a use case where
devices should be in the same VLAN, that seems a totaly useless and
harmfull feature.
